25 Mbps and 130 mV hysteresis — what they mean on the bus
The 25 Mbps data rate supports high-speed polling or streaming between PLCs, drives, and remote I/O nodes over twisted-pair cable. At this rate the bus length is limited by cable attenuation and termination — expect reliable links up to roughly 50–100 meters, depending on cable quality and stub length. The 130 mV hysteresis on the receiver input filters out noise and ringing on the differential pair, which matters when the cable runs alongside motor drives or VFDs. A lower-hysteresis part would chatter on the same layout. The through-hole PDIP package is a rework-friendly choice for prototype boards, legacy maintenance, or applications where vibration resistance from a socketed DIP is preferred over a surface-mount package.
